"Covert" is a word in LAW AND LEGAL, ENGLISH

Covert LAW AND LEGAL
Definition:

Covered, protected, sheltered-A pound covert is one that is close or covered over, as distinguished from pound overt, which ls open overhead. Co. Litt 47b; 3 BL Comm. 12. A feme covert is so called, as being under the wing, protection, or cover of her husband. 1 Bl. Comm. 442
